Riverside Research is an independent nonprofit organization dedicated to enhancing national security through innovation and scientific research. The organization focuses on various advanced technologies, including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ning, secure systems, and advanced radar systems, to support the U. S. government's mission-related activities. Riverside Research emphasizes collaborative innovation, delivering high-quality solutions in areas like int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ance, while also fostering a culture of community engagement and STEM outreach.

📋 Description

• Design, implement, and optimize FPGA logic using AMD/Xilinx toolchains (Vivado, Vitis, HLS) development in VHDL/Verilog • Integrate FPGA designs into larger systems, ensuring robust verification, documentation, and deployment across multiple platforms (Zynq, UltraScale+, Versal) • Develop innovative machine learning and computer vision solutions to analyze and exploit large, complex datasets from remote sensing phenomenology • Develop algorithms and associated software tools using C/C++/Python and associated machine learning libraries (PyTorch, LibTorch) • Train AI/ML models and tune their hyperparameters for a given dataset and algorithm objectives • Provide solutions for data collection and data linting that enable rapid, automated curation of training data • Keep up with the SoTA practices for AI/ML • Adhere to teams’ standards for reviewing source code, unit-testing, source code control, and documentation practices • Utilize Python PEP8 standards

🎯 Requirements

• TS/SCI clearance. • Bachelors’ degree in either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Mathematics, Statistics, Physics, Computer Science, or related field of study • Twelve years’ experience with FPGA development • Seven years' experience with computer vision and/or AI/ML R&D algorithm development • Experience with Git version control, branches, and merge conflict resolution • Proficient in collaborative Office 365 tools such as MS Word, Excel, and PowerPoint • Ability to work closely with subject-matter experts to develop tools, algorithms, and datasets needed for developing relevant and useful AI/ML prototype algorithms • Self-driven, strong analytic, inferencing, critical thinking, and creative problem-solving skills • Communicates highly technical results and methods clearly and succinctly.
